Virtual reality could help med students stop getting lost in hospitals

NCT ID NCT05894005

First seen Dec 29, 2025 · Last updated May 21, 2026 · Updated 16 times

Summary

This study tests whether immersive 360-degree virtual reality videos are better than standard 2D videos at teaching medical students how to navigate a hospital. About 44 medical students will be asked to find a new location after watching either a VR or a regular video. Researchers will measure how long it takes and how often students get lost, with the goal of reducing anxiety and improving orientation.
